| Subject: [PATCH] CVE-2022-23219: Buffer overflow in sunrpc clnt_create for |
| "unix" (bug 22542) |
| |
| Processing an overlong pathname in the sunrpc clnt_create function |
| results in a stack-based buffer overflow. |

| diff --git a/sunrpc/clnt_gen.c b/sunrpc/clnt_gen.c |
| index 13ced8994e..b44357cd88 100644 |
| --- a/sunrpc/clnt_gen.c |
| +++ b/sunrpc/clnt_gen.c |
| @@ -57,9 +57,13 @@ clnt_create (const char *hostname, u_lon |
| |
| if (strcmp (proto, "unix") == 0) |
| { |
| - memset ((char *)&sun, 0, sizeof (sun)); |
| - sun.sun_family = AF_UNIX; |
| - strcpy (sun.sun_path, hostname); |
| + if (__sockaddr_un_set (&sun, hostname) < 0) |
| + { |
| + struct rpc_createerr *ce = &get_rpc_createerr (); |
| + ce->cf_stat = RPC_SYSTEMERROR; |
| + ce->cf_error.re_errno = errno; |
| + return NULL; |
| + } |
| sock = RPC_ANYSOCK; |
| client = clntunix_create (&sun, prog, vers, &sock, 0, 0); |
| if (client == NULL) |
